13 recalls on record for the 2015 Ford F-150
- NHTSA 26V237000 · 2026 · POWER TRAIN:AUTOMATIC TRANSMISSION Unexpectedly downshifting into second gear may result in a loss of vehicle control, increasing the risk of a crash.

Open TCO calculatorThese are unverified consumer reports and manufacturer recalls filed with the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ration — not validated defect rates, and not adjusted for how many 2015 Ford F-150 units were produced or sold. High-volume and older vehicles naturally accumulate more complaints. Use this as one research signal, not a verdict on any individual vehicle. Data as of 2026. Source: NHTSA Office of Defects Investigation (public domain).
Frequently asked questions
Is the 2015 Ford F-150 reliable?
NHTSA has 2,122 consumer complaints on record for the 2015 Ford F-150 and 13 recalls. The most-reported problem area is power train (335 reports). These are unverified consumer reports filed with the government, not validated failure rates, and are not adjusted for how many 2015 Ford F-150 units were produced — popular vehicles naturally accumulate more reports.
What are the most common problems with the 2015 Ford F-150?
Owners most often report problems with: power train (335), service brakes (295), engine (252), unknown or other (194). Each figure is the number of complaints filed with NHTSA for this exact model year.
